Why These Are the Top Jeep Repair Auto Repair Shops in Thornville

** The Jeep repair and modification market serving Thornville, Ohio, is characteristic of a semi-rural area with a strong outdoor and off-road culture. While Thornville itself has limited dedicated specialty shops, the immediate region is well-served by highly competent providers, creating a competitive and quality-driven environment. * **Average Quality:** The quality of specialized Jeep service is high. The top-tier shops (like J&B Varsity and 4x4 Unlimited) operate at a national-level standard of expertise, capable of handling complex diagnostics, custom fabrication, and advanced powertrain work. Local garages provide competent general service. * **Competition Level:** Competition is healthy. Shops differentiate themselves through specialization—some focus on radical custom builds, while others excel in precise mechanical rebuilding or offer convenient local service. This benefits the consumer by providing clear choices based on their specific needs. *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is competitive with national averages but can be lower than in major metropolitan areas. Basic service (oil changes, brake work) is reasonably priced. Specialized work (lift kit installations, differential re-gearing, engine swaps) commands a premium due to the required expertise, with labor rates typically ranging from $110-$150 per hour at the top specialty shops. Customers report receiving good value for the quality of workmanship.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about jeep repair services in Thornville, OH

What are the most common Jeep repair issues you see in Thornville, and are they affected by our local roads or climate?

In Thornville, we frequently address suspension components like ball joints and track bars due to rough rural roads, as well as 4x4 system issues from seasonal mud and winter salt. Electrical problems, particularly with older Wranglers, are also common and can be exacerbated by our humid summers and wet conditions.

How can I find a quality, trustworthy Jeep repair shop in the Thornville area?

Look for shops that are active in the local off-road community or are recommended by groups like the Buckeye Jeep Alliance. A quality shop will have specific diagnostic tools for Jeep systems (like the Wrangler's ABS) and technicians certified by ASE or with brand-specific training.

When should I seek local service for my Jeep's 4x4 system versus trying to fix it myself?

You should seek a professional Thornville shop immediately if you experience grinding noises, difficulty shifting into 4WD, or the "Service 4WD" light appears. Given the complex transfer cases and electronic shifters in modern Jeeps, improper DIY fixes can lead to very costly damage.

Are repair costs for Jeeps generally higher in Thornville compared to nearby cities like Columbus?

Labor rates in Thornville are often more competitive than in major metro areas, but parts costs remain consistent. The advantage of using a local specialist is their efficiency in diagnosing common Jeep problems, which can save on total labor time compared to a general shop.

What local considerations should I discuss with my Thornville mechanic when preparing my Jeep for seasonal changes?

Discuss undercarriage rust prevention treatments before winter due to Ohio road salt, and ensuring your cooling system and air conditioning are robust for humid summer trails. Also, if you use your Jeep on local private trails or at the Buckeye Lake area, mention this so they can inspect for specific wear.
